Where the Money Leaks

Transportation inefficiencies tend to hide in plain sight. Here are some of the most common culprits:

  • Carrier selection based on convenience instead of cost, reliability, or service level

  • Poor shipment planning, leading to half-empty trailers, redundant runs, or excessive parcel usage

  • Lack of visibility into extra charges—detention, accessorials, fuel surcharges—that accumulate over time

  • Empty miles on dedicated fleets due to poor route design or no backhauls

  • Reactive operations that leave logistics scrambling to make up for planning gaps elsewhere in the business

Each of these factors can chip away at your bottom line. Worse, they can leave your customers waiting—or looking elsewhere.

From Cost Center to Competitive Advantage

When transportation is approached strategically, it does more than move product—it supports growth, lowers operating expenses, and builds trust with customers.

Key steps include:

  • Route optimization based on delivery windows, density, and cost

  • Carrier scorecards that reward performance and drive accountability

  • Real-time tracking and exception management to minimize service failures

  • Leveraging data to identify trends—not just respond to issues after the fact
